On a freezing January night in rural Northumberland, 28-year-old taxi driver Evelyn Foster picked up a male passenger for what should have been a routine fare. Hours later, she was found severely burned beside her smouldering car on a remote stretch of road.

Before she died from her injuries, Evelyn gave a disturbing account of an attack — one involving a mysterious man, a struggle, and a fire that consumed everything except the unanswered questions.

Despite a large-scale investigation, conflicting witness statements, and Evelyn’s own fading testimony, no one was ever charged. This case remains one of the most debated and enigmatic murders in early 20th-century Britain.
